The editorial take

The Larder runs a full bar with eight signature cocktails at $15, a brunch list of Bloody Mary variations and coffee cocktails, and a Boozy Coffee section at $13 each. Beer covers domestic bottles, regional craft cans like Creature Comforts Tropicalia and SweetWater 420, and non-alcoholic options. The non-alcoholic side is broader than most: two NA beers, a canna seltzer, and a coffee menu that includes a pistachio matcha latte with house pistachio whipped cream.

What should I order?
Start with the Melon Pepino Mojito, built on Havana Blanco rum with fresh mint and cucumber, or the Lemon Meringue with Botanist Gin, limoncello, St. Germain, and egg white. For beer, the Creature Comforts Tropicalia IPA is the standout can at $7. The pistachio matcha latte is the non-alcoholic pick.
Who will enjoy this place?
Anyone weighing a cocktail against a craft beer or a coffee drink will find a full spread here. The brunch cocktails and boozy coffees suit a morning or early afternoon visit, while the signature list covers rum, whiskey, vodka, and gin bases.
When should I go?
The brunch menu lists four additional cocktails, including two Bloody Mary variations and a Good Morning Vietnamese, making brunch a supported time to visit. The Boozy Coffee section is also available for coffee-and-spirit orders.
What should I expect to spend?
Signature cocktails are $15 each, brunch cocktails run $13-$15, and boozy coffees are $13. Beer ranges from $4.25 to $5.25 for bottles and $4 to $7 for cans, with non-alcoholic beer at $3.75-$4.25. Coffee drinks span $3.25 to $7, and the canna seltzer is $7.5.
What makes the beverage program distinctive?
The Larder pairs a full cocktail list with a Boozy Coffee section and a non-alcoholic program that includes two NA beers, a canna seltzer, and a pistachio matcha latte with house pistachio whipped cream. The beer list mixes domestic bottles with regional craft cans like Tropicalia and SweetWater 420.

Cocktails

Inebrious Cocktails score: 87 out of 100

Eight signature cocktails at $15, four brunch cocktails at $13-$15, and five coffee cocktails at $13. Spirits include rum, whiskey, vodka, gin, and liqueurs, with house-made elements like lavender simple, rosemary simple, and white sangria mix.

Menu strengths

  • Eight signature cocktails anchor the list, with the Melon Pepino Mojito using fresh mint and cucumber and the Lemon Meringue finishing with egg white.
  • Brunch adds four cocktails at $13-$15, including two Bloody Mary variations, an Iced Coffee Old Fashioned, and a Classic Espresso Martini.
  • A Boozy Coffee section lists five coffee cocktails at $13 each.

Standout selections

  • Melon Pepino Mojito — Havana Blanco rum, watermelon schnapps, lime, simple, fresh mint, fresh cucumber, $15.
  • Lemon Meringue — Botanist Gin, limoncello, St. Germain, simple, lemon, egg white, $15.
  • Herbal Remedy — Cathead honeysuckle vodka, Izarra, house rosemary simple, lime, $15.
  • Blushing Whiskey — Jack Daniel's Honey, grapefruit juice, lime, house lavender simple, $15.

Pricing: $15 for eight signature cocktails; $13-$15 for brunch cocktails; $13 for boozy coffees

Beer

Inebrious Beer score: 84 out of 100

Bottled beers cover Bud Light, Michelob Ultra, Miller Lite, Yuengling, Blue Moon, and Stella Artois. Cans include Creature Comforts Tropicalia IPA, SweetWater 420 Extra Pale Ale, Savannah River Brewing Co. No Jacket Required Pilsner, Hopfly Endless Reign Hazy IPA, and Pabst Blue Ribbon.

Menu strengths

  • The canned list moves beyond standard domestic labels with Creature Comforts Tropicalia, SweetWater 420, and Hopfly Endless Reign Hazy IPA.
  • Bottles and cans together span $4 to $7, with domestic bottles at the lower end.
  • Non-alcoholic beers Athletic Lite and Untitled Art Hazy IPA are also listed.

Standout selections

  • Creature Comforts Tropicalia IPA — Athens, GA, 12oz can, $7.
  • SweetWater 420 Extra Pale Ale — Atlanta, GA, 12oz can, $6.
  • Savannah River Brewing Co. No Jacket Required Pilsner — canned beer.

Pricing: Bottles $4.25-$5.25; cans $4-$7; non-alcoholic beer $3.75-$4.25

Nonalcoholic

Inebrious Nonalcoholic score: 88 out of 100

Non-alcoholic beer includes Athletic Lite and Untitled Art Hazy IPA. A High Rise Canna Seltzer is listed with flavors varying. The coffee menu covers Brazilian Drip, espresso, latte, cappuccino, and a pistachio matcha latte with almond milk and house pistachio whipped cream.

Menu strengths

  • Two non-alcoholic beers, Athletic Lite and Untitled Art Hazy IPA, give the NA list more than a token option.
  • The High Rise Canna Seltzer adds a non-alcoholic alternative beyond beer and coffee.
  • Coffee drinks range from a $3.25 Brazilian Drip to a $7 pistachio matcha latte with house pistachio whipped cream.

Standout selections

  • Pistachio Matcha Latte — iced matcha latte, almond milk, house pistachio whipped cream, $7.
  • Untitled Art Hazy IPA — non-alcoholic beer, $4.25.
  • High Rise Canna Seltzer — flavors vary, $7.5.

Pricing: NA beer $3.75-$4.25; canna seltzer $7.5; coffee $3.25-$7
